python课程研究报告
《Python课程研究报告》
一、引言学python需要什么
Python作为一门高级的编程语言,具有简单易学、跨平台、动态类型等优势。在近年来,Python在编程教育领域逐渐流行起来,并被广泛应用于大学计算机教育、人工智能、数据分析等领域。本报告旨在对Python课程进行深入研究,分析其教学目标、教学内容、教学方法以及实际应用等方面的内容。
二、教学目标
1. 提高学生的编程能力:通过Python课程的学习,学生能够掌握Python语法、函数、模块等基本知识,具备独立编写和调试Python程序的能力。
2. 培养学生的逻辑思维能力:通过编程实践,培养学生的逻辑思维能力,提高学生的问题分析和解决问题的能力。
3. 提升学生的创新思维:通过Python课程的学习,培养学生的创新思维,激发学生的创造力,通过编写具有实际应用的程序实现自己的创意。
三、教学内容
Python课程的内容一般包括以下几个方面:
1. 基础语法:学习Python的基本语法,包括变量、运算符、控制语句、循环结构等;学习Python的数据类型,如整数、浮点数、字符串、列表、元组、字典等。
2. 函数与模块:学习如何定义和调用函数,学习如何编写和使用模块,提高代码的重用性。
3. 文件操作:学习如何读写文件,包括文本文件和二进制文件的读写操作。
4. 异常处理:学习如何处理程序运行中可能出现的异常,增强程序的健壮性。
5. Web开发:学习如何使用Python进行Web开发,如使用Django等Web框架进行网站的开发;学习如何使用Flask等微框架构建简单的Web应用。
6. 数据分析与可视化:学习如何使用Python进行数据分析,如使用Pandas等库进行数据处理和分析;学习如何使用Matplotlib等库进行数据可视化。
四、教学方法
1. 讲授与实践相结合:教师通过讲授Python的基本知识和技巧,引导学生进行编程实践,通过实践加深对知识的理解。
2. 项目实践:设计具有实际应用价值的项目,让学生在项目中运用所学的知识进行编程实践,培养学生的实际操作能力。
3. 互动学习:鼓励学生之间的讨论与交流,促进学生的学习兴趣和思维碰撞,培养团队合作意识。
五、实际应用
Python在多个领域具有广泛的应用价值。通过Python课程的学习,学生可以应用所学知识进行以下实际应用:
1. 数据分析与可视化:可以使用Python进行大数据分析、数据清洗、数据处理和数据可视化,应用于金融、市场调研、医疗等领域。
2. 人工智能领域:可以使用Python进行机器学习和深度学习的算法实现,应用于图像识别、自然语言处理等领域。
3. Web开发:可以使用Python进行Web开发,开发各类网站和Web应用,应用于电商、社交网络等领域。
4. 自动化测试:可以使用Python进行自动化测试,提高测试效率,保证软件质量。
六、结论
Python课程的设立对于提高学生的编程能力、培养学生的逻辑思维能力、提升学生的创新思维具有重要意义。针对不同学生的需求,可以结合实际应用,通过讲授、实践与项目开发相结合的教学方法,提高学生的学习兴趣和学习效果。未来,Python课程将在计算机教育领域起到更加重要的作用,对学生的职业发展具有重要意义。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。